WebList and Describe the components of secondary assessment. -Physical Examination (Feel, look) -Vital Signs (BP, respirations, Pulse, pulse oximetry, skin CTC, pupils) -Patient History (HPI History of Present Illness and PMH Past Medical History) Sign vs Symptom. Sign- something you can see. Symptom- something patient tells you.

WebNov 13, 2024 · DCAP-BTLS: deformities, contusions, abrasions, punctures/penetrations, burns, tenderness, lacerations and swelling. What does the acronym sample? SAMPLE (History) This acronym is the gold standard for a subjective history of a patient and is used on the medical and trauma checklist for the state exam.
